Unpacking FDM 3D Printing in Malaysia


FDM 3D printing is a popular additive manufacturing technique that utilizes thermoplastic filaments. In Malaysia, this technology is embraced across industries for its simplicity, cost-effectiveness, and versatility. But how does FDM 3D printing work?

How FDM 3D Printing Works


The FDM process begins with a spool of thermoplastic filament, typically made of materials like PLA or ABS. The filament is heated to its melting point within the 3D printer’s nozzle. The melted material is then extruded layer by layer onto a build platform, gradually forming the desired object based on a digital model. FDM’s layer-by-layer approach makes it an excellent choice for prototyping, manufacturing, and even educational purposes in Malaysia.

Benefits of FDM 3D Printing in Malaysia


Affordability and Accessibility:
FDM 3D printers are known for their affordability, making them accessible to a broad audience in Malaysia. Whether you’re a hobbyist, entrepreneur, or part of an educational institution, FDM technology offers a cost-effective entry point into 3D printing.

Material Variety:
FDM 3D printing in Malaysia provides a diverse range of thermoplastic materials, each with distinct properties. From the biodegradable PLA for eco-friendly projects to the robust ABS for durable prototypes, the material options cater to a myriad of applications.

Ease of Use:
The straightforward nature of FDM 3D printing makes it user-friendly, especially for those new to the technology in Malaysia. With minimal setup and maintenance requirements, FDM printers are an excellent choice for individuals and small businesses.

Tips for Optimizing FDM 3D Printing in Malaysia
Calibrate Your Printer Regularly:

Precise calibration ensures the accuracy and quality of FDM prints. Regularly calibrating your 3D printer in Malaysia helps avoid issues such as layer misalignment or warping, ensuring consistent results.

Experiment with Print Settings:
Understanding and experimenting with print settings, such as layer height and infill density, can significantly impact the final outcome. Tailor these settings based on the specific requirements of your project.

Utilize Support Structures Strategically:
FDM printing often requires support structures for overhanging features. However, strategic placement and optimized settings can minimize the need for excessive supports, reducing material usage and post-processing efforts.
